Position overview: the trade compliance and logistics support role will focus on ensuring compliant import/export operations for accelleron's mexico operations, including customs, freight, and data management.
your responsibilities
* trade compliance & customs support : day‑to‑day import and export compliance activities for mexico operations; support accurate customs tariff classification (hs codes), nams, and customs valuation in coordination with brokers and internal stakeholders; support free trade agreement (fta) utilization (e.g., usmca), including preferential origin documentation and recordkeeping; coordinate with customs brokers for timely and compliant customs clearance; maintain organized and auditable trade compliance documentation (certificates of origin, import/export records, broker files); support customs audits, internal trade reviews, and corrective actions; identify potential trade compliance risks or deviations and elevate accordingly.
* transportation & logistics support : manage inbound and outbound transportation activities (road, air, sea, courier) in line with service and compliance requirements; monitor shipments, transit times, and delivery performance; support issue resolution with logistics service providers; support freight cost analysis, carrier performance monitoring, and logistics kpi tracking; contribute to continuous improvement initiatives related to transportation flows and logistics processes.
* systems, data & reporting : support tt&l processes within erp and trade compliance systems (e.g., sap/gts or equivalent); maintain accurate master data related to incoterms, customs, and logistics parameters; prepare and update tt&l trackers and reports, including compliance metrics, savings initiatives, and operational dashboards; provide data and analysis for regional and global tt&l reporting.
* collaboration & governance : act as the local tt&l point of contact for mexico, supporting business stakeholders while ensuring alignment with regional tt&l governance; work closely with the regional tt&l manager – americas on compliance topics, projects, audits, and process standardization; support tt&l supervision and controlling activities, including tib‑related processes; participate in regional tt&l initiatives and continuous improvement projects.
your background
* education : bachelor’s degree in international trade, logistics, supply chain, business administration, or related field.
* experience : 2–4 years in trade compliance, customs, logistics, or transportation, preferably in an international or industrial environment, with knowledge of mexican customs regulations and incoterms.
* languages : spanish (fluent/native) and english (business fluent).
